About Skene

Skene is an AI-powered, fully automated Product-Led Growth (PLG) infrastructure that fundamentally reimagines growth tooling by integrating directly with a product's codebase. It functions as a self-learning growth engine, eliminating the need for external scripts, siloed dashboards, and manual optimization. The platform operates by first analyzing a user's code to understand the product's structure and user flows. It then automatically observes user behavior to detect friction points and drop-offs in critical journeys like onboarding and activation. Using this intelligence, Skene autonomously creates, A/B tests, and deploys improved versions of these flows, continuously optimizing for key metrics like activation and retention without human intervention. Its core value proposition is turning growth into a programmable, owned layer of infrastructure rather than a collection of brittle third-party services. Primarily built for indie developers, early-stage startups, and established PLG companies, Skene serves as a "growth team in a box." It enables technical teams to scale their product's growth loops efficiently without adding headcount or sacrificing the technical control, performance, and data ownership intrinsic to their core product.

What is PLG software?

PLG (Product-Led Growth) software is designed to help users discover value in a product without manual intervention from sales or customer success teams. It automates the user journey, guiding users to activation, driving feature adoption, and strengthening retention through the product experience itself. According to industry frameworks, effective PLG turns the product into the primary acquisition, conversion, and expansion channel.

How is Skene different from traditional customer experience software?

Traditional tools like walkthrough builders require manual tour creation, constant maintenance, and rely on brittle UI selectors that break with every code deploy. Skene is fundamentally different; it reads your codebase to understand your product's structure and automatically generates and maintains onboarding, analytics, and automation. When you push new code, Skene's understanding and implementations update themselves, eliminating maintenance overhead and selector fragility.
